The new update for the CMF Phone 1 It's here, although, as usual, the rollout will be staggered. This means that not all users will receive the firmware at the same time. This strategy allows Nothing to detect potential bugs and ensure a stable and trouble-free implementation.
What's new in the update
🔒 Password verification on shutdownNow, if you lose your phone, no one will be able to turn it off without entering your password. A much-needed extra layer of security. To activate it, search for 'Power-off verification' in Settings.
General improvements and bug fixes
🖼️ Optimized pop-up view designPop-up windows are now cleaner and smoother, offering a better visual experience.
⚙️ Improved functionality in SettingsNavigating the settings menu is more intuitive and faster.
🔒 February security patchKeep your device protected with the latest security updates.
📈 Greater system stability: Overall performance has been polished to deliver a smoother experience.

This update reinforces Nothing's commitment to security and user experience. The new power-off verification feature is a great addition, especially considering how easy it is to lose a phone these days. While the visual and stability improvements are subtle, they are noticeable in everyday use.
